Bioinformatics Pipeline For Epigenomics
Explore diverse perspectives on bioinformatics pipelines with structured content covering tools, applications, optimization, and future trends.
In the age of genomics, the ability to assemble genomes accurately and efficiently has become a cornerstone of modern biological research. Whether you're working on de novo genome assembly or resequencing projects, a well-constructed bioinformatics pipeline is essential for success. Genome assembly is the process of piecing together DNA sequences to reconstruct the original genome, and it plays a pivotal role in understanding genetic information, identifying mutations, and exploring evolutionary relationships. However, the complexity of this task requires a robust and optimized pipeline that integrates cutting-edge tools, technologies, and best practices. This article serves as a comprehensive guide to building, optimizing, and applying a bioinformatics pipeline for genome assembly, offering actionable insights for professionals in the field.
Implement [Bioinformatics Pipeline] solutions for seamless cross-team collaboration and data analysis.
Understanding the basics of a bioinformatics pipeline for genome assembly
Key Components of a Bioinformatics Pipeline for Genome Assembly
A bioinformatics pipeline for genome assembly is a structured workflow that integrates various computational tools and algorithms to process raw sequencing data into a complete genome. The key components include:
- Data Preprocessing: This involves quality control (QC) of raw sequencing reads, trimming low-quality bases, and removing adapter sequences. Tools like FastQC and Trimmomatic are commonly used.
- Read Alignment or Overlap Detection: Depending on the assembly type (de novo or reference-guided), reads are either aligned to a reference genome or overlapped to identify contiguous sequences.
- Assembly Algorithms: These include graph-based methods like De Bruijn graphs for short reads and overlap-layout-consensus (OLC) for long reads.
- Error Correction: Post-assembly error correction ensures the accuracy of the assembled genome.
- Scaffolding and Gap Filling: Scaffolding arranges contigs into larger sequences, while gap filling resolves missing regions.
- Annotation: Functional annotation assigns biological meaning to the assembled genome, identifying genes, regulatory elements, and other features.
Importance of a Bioinformatics Pipeline for Genome Assembly in Modern Research
Genome assembly is foundational to numerous fields, including genomics, transcriptomics, and metagenomics. Its importance lies in:
- Understanding Genetic Diversity: Genome assembly enables the study of genetic variation within and between species, aiding in evolutionary biology and population genetics.
- Advancing Precision Medicine: Assembling human genomes helps identify disease-causing mutations and develop targeted therapies.
- Agricultural Improvements: Assembling plant and animal genomes supports crop improvement and livestock breeding programs.
- Environmental Studies: Metagenomic assembly helps explore microbial communities in diverse ecosystems, revealing their roles in biogeochemical cycles.
Building an effective bioinformatics pipeline for genome assembly
Tools and Technologies for Genome Assembly
The success of a bioinformatics pipeline depends on selecting the right tools and technologies. Key tools include:
- Sequencing Platforms: Illumina (short reads), PacBio, and Oxford Nanopore (long reads) are widely used.
- Assembly Software: SPAdes, Velvet, and SOAPdenovo for short reads; Canu and Flye for long reads.
- Error Correction Tools: Pilon and Racon improve assembly accuracy.
- Visualization Tools: Bandage and IGV help visualize assembly graphs and alignments.
Step-by-Step Guide to Genome Assembly Pipeline Implementation
- Data Acquisition: Obtain raw sequencing data from high-throughput platforms.
- Quality Control: Use FastQC to assess read quality and Trimmomatic to trim low-quality bases.
- Read Assembly: Choose an appropriate assembler based on read type (e.g., SPAdes for short reads, Canu for long reads).
- Error Correction: Apply tools like Pilon to correct assembly errors.
- Scaffolding and Gap Filling: Use tools like SSPACE and GapCloser to improve assembly continuity.
- Annotation: Employ tools like Prokka or MAKER for functional annotation.
- Validation: Validate the assembly using metrics like N50, BUSCO scores, and alignment rates.
Related:
Corporate Tax PlanningClick here to utilize our free project management templates!
Optimizing your bioinformatics pipeline for genome assembly
Common Challenges in Genome Assembly
Genome assembly is fraught with challenges, including:
- Repetitive Sequences: These can lead to misassemblies or fragmented assemblies.
- High Error Rates in Long Reads: While long reads improve contiguity, they often have higher error rates.
- Computational Demands: Assembly algorithms require significant computational resources.
- Contamination: Contaminant sequences can skew assembly results.
Best Practices for Genome Assembly Efficiency
To overcome these challenges, consider the following best practices:
- Hybrid Assembly: Combine short and long reads to leverage the strengths of both.
- Resource Optimization: Use cloud computing or high-performance clusters for computationally intensive tasks.
- Iterative Refinement: Perform multiple rounds of assembly and error correction.
- Contamination Screening: Use tools like Kraken or BLAST to identify and remove contaminant sequences.
Applications of genome assembly across industries
Genome Assembly in Healthcare and Medicine
Genome assembly has revolutionized healthcare by enabling:
- Disease Diagnosis: Identifying genetic mutations associated with diseases.
- Drug Development: Discovering new drug targets through genome analysis.
- Personalized Medicine: Tailoring treatments based on individual genetic profiles.
Genome Assembly in Environmental Studies
In environmental research, genome assembly facilitates:
- Microbial Ecology: Assembling genomes of unculturable microbes from metagenomic data.
- Bioremediation: Identifying microbial species capable of degrading pollutants.
- Climate Change Studies: Understanding the genetic basis of adaptation to changing environments.
Related:
Corporate Tax PlanningClick here to utilize our free project management templates!
Future trends in bioinformatics pipelines for genome assembly
Emerging Technologies in Genome Assembly
The field of genome assembly is rapidly evolving, with emerging technologies such as:
- Hi-C and Linked-Read Sequencing: These methods improve scaffolding and resolve complex regions.
- Artificial Intelligence: Machine learning algorithms enhance error correction and assembly accuracy.
- Single-Cell Genomics: Advances in single-cell sequencing enable the assembly of individual cell genomes.
Predictions for Genome Assembly Development
Future developments are likely to focus on:
- Real-Time Assembly: On-the-fly assembly during sequencing runs.
- Pan-Genome Assembly: Constructing comprehensive reference genomes for entire species.
- Cost Reduction: Making genome assembly accessible to smaller labs and developing countries.
Examples of bioinformatics pipelines for genome assembly
Example 1: De Novo Assembly of a Plant Genome
A research team used Illumina and PacBio sequencing to assemble the genome of a drought-resistant plant. They employed SPAdes for initial assembly, followed by scaffolding with SSPACE and annotation with Prokka. The assembly revealed novel genes associated with drought tolerance.
Example 2: Metagenomic Assembly of a Microbial Community
Scientists studying a marine ecosystem used Oxford Nanopore sequencing to assemble microbial genomes. They applied Flye for assembly and Kraken for contamination screening. The results provided insights into microbial roles in nutrient cycling.
Example 3: Human Genome Resequencing for Disease Research
A clinical study used Illumina sequencing to resequence the genome of a patient with a rare genetic disorder. The pipeline included BWA for alignment, GATK for variant calling, and Pilon for error correction. The analysis identified a novel mutation linked to the disorder.
Click here to utilize our free project management templates!
Tips for do's and don'ts in genome assembly pipelines
Do's | Don'ts |
---|---|
Perform thorough quality control of raw data. | Ignore contamination screening. |
Use hybrid assembly for complex genomes. | Rely solely on short reads for large genomes. |
Validate assembly with multiple metrics. | Skip error correction steps. |
Optimize computational resources. | Overlook the need for scalable infrastructure. |
Document every step of the pipeline. | Use outdated tools or algorithms. |
Faqs about bioinformatics pipelines for genome assembly
What is the primary purpose of a bioinformatics pipeline for genome assembly?
The primary purpose is to reconstruct a complete genome from raw sequencing data, enabling researchers to study genetic information, identify mutations, and explore evolutionary relationships.
How can I start building a bioinformatics pipeline for genome assembly?
Start by defining your research goals, selecting appropriate sequencing platforms, and choosing tools for each step of the pipeline, from quality control to annotation.
What are the most common tools used in genome assembly?
Common tools include FastQC for quality control, SPAdes and Canu for assembly, Pilon for error correction, and Prokka for annotation.
How do I ensure the accuracy of a genome assembly?
Ensure accuracy by performing multiple rounds of error correction, validating the assembly with metrics like N50 and BUSCO scores, and using high-quality input data.
What industries benefit the most from genome assembly?
Industries such as healthcare, agriculture, environmental science, and biotechnology benefit significantly from genome assembly, as it enables advancements in disease research, crop improvement, and microbial ecology.
This comprehensive guide provides a detailed roadmap for professionals looking to master the bioinformatics pipeline for genome assembly. By understanding the basics, leveraging the right tools, and following best practices, you can achieve accurate and efficient genome assemblies that drive impactful research and innovation.
Implement [Bioinformatics Pipeline] solutions for seamless cross-team collaboration and data analysis.